About the Ending A Fixed Term Contract Early
When you need to terminate a fixed-term employment contract before its scheduled end date in Singapore, you require a legally compliant agreement that protects both parties while ensuring adherence to local employment laws. An early termination agreement provides the necessary framework to end the employment relationship properly, covering financial settlements, notice periods, and ongoing obligations under Singapore's Employment Act.
When do you need this document?
You need an early termination agreement when business circumstances require ending a fixed-term contract prematurely. This commonly occurs during company restructuring, budget cuts, or project cancellations that make continuing the employment relationship impractical. The document is also essential when an employee wishes to leave before contract completion for personal reasons, career opportunities, or relocation. Additionally, you'll need this agreement when performance issues arise that cannot be resolved within the remaining contract period, or when both parties mutually recognize that continuing the employment relationship is no longer beneficial.
Key legal considerations
The agreement must clearly specify the termination date and ensure proper notice periods are provided according to the Employment Act requirements. Financial settlements require careful calculation, including final salary payments, accrued annual leave, bonuses, and any compensation for early termination. You should include mutual release clauses to prevent future claims between parties, while ensuring any post-employment obligations like confidentiality and non-compete clauses remain enforceable. The document must address the return of company property, completion of handover procedures, and provision of employment references. Consider including dispute resolution mechanisms to handle any disagreements that may arise from the early termination process.
Legal requirements in Singapore
Under Singapore's Employment Act, early termination of fixed-term contracts must comply with specific notice periods and payment obligations. The Employment Claims Act 2016 provides the framework for resolving any disputes that may arise from the termination process through Employment Claims Tribunals. If the employee is unionized, the Industrial Relations Act may apply, requiring consultation with relevant unions before termination. Common law principles regarding contractual breach and remedies must be considered, particularly regarding compensation for early termination. Ministry of Manpower guidelines provide additional requirements for proper termination procedures, including timely settlement of final payments and benefits. The agreement should ensure compliance with these statutory requirements while protecting both parties from potential legal claims arising from the early contract termination.
